- Stevia,
a high value medicinal plant whose dry leaves can be used by
diabetics, has been successfully cultivated in Debang valley
district of Arunachal Pradesh and is ready for commercial
harvesting.
PB Kanjilal, head of medicinal plant division of Regional
Research Laboratory (RRL) of Jorhat, said the laboratory had
adopted several villages at Roing in Debang valley to
motivate 300 farmers to cultivate the plant whose leaves are
far sweeter than sugar and can be used by diabetics.
The particular area was selected as the climatic condition
there was ideal for the cultivation of stevia, he said.
Stevia plants yield 2,500 kg dry leaves per acre per annum
and one kg green leaves can fetch Rs 125.
- J S Sandha (in Jalandhar, Punjab ), who’s growing herbal
plants like Stevia Rebaudiana — a natural sweetener without
calories — and herbal tea on his 15-acre farm in Uppal
Khalsa village in Noormahal says: ‘‘Herbs are a good
proposition. They fetch you Rs 1.5 lakh an acre annually.’’
Last year, Sandha exported Stevia worth Rs 15 lakh with the
help of his UK-based friend Kewal Singh Uppal. Now the two
plan to expand their business to Belgium and France.

- Stevosides contain zero calories and can be used as a
sugar substitute in cooking and baking. They are especially
beneficial to diabetics and those wishing to reduce sugar
intake for health reasons. Its primary use is as a sweetener
to enhance the palatability of food and drinks. Unlike
aspartame, Stevia sweeteners are heat stable to 200 degrees
centigrade, are acid stable and do not ferment, making them
suitable for use in a wide range of products
